席雷平,陳自力,李小民
(解放軍軍械工程學(xué)院,石家莊 050003)
地形匹配導(dǎo)航作為一種高精度的自主導(dǎo)航方式,被廣泛運用于飛行器等武器裝備上,大大提高了武器系統(tǒng)的作戰(zhàn)效能。然而,在地形匹配導(dǎo)航系統(tǒng)中,導(dǎo)航精度在很大程度上取決于地形的獨特性(適配性),所以地形適配區(qū)的選擇至關(guān)重要。文中從熵的概念入手,利用高程信息給出地形熵的定義,提出了基于地形熵的地形適配區(qū)選擇準則,并在生成的DEM數(shù)字地圖的基礎(chǔ)上,對該適配區(qū)選擇準則進行了仿真,結(jié)果表明該準則具有較好的地形適配區(qū)選擇性能。
自從香農(nóng)將物理中熵的概念引入到信息論以來,熵已被廣泛應(yīng)用于信號處理、圖像處理等各種領(lǐng)域。設(shè)某信息源中包含的符號si有q個,相應(yīng)的出現(xiàn)概率為P(si)。如果該信息源中符號序列的長度為N,當N較大時,該符號序列中出現(xiàn)符號si的個數(shù)為NP(si)個,出現(xiàn)NP(si)個si符號共得到的信息量為-NP(si)logP(si)。那么N個符號全部的信息量為:I= -NP(s1)logP(s1)- … -NP(sq)logP(sq)=
平均每個符號的信息量為:
由式(2)可知,當q個符號出現(xiàn)的概率相差較大時,其熵值較小,反之,熵值較大。當q個符號等概率出現(xiàn)時,H(S)=logq,這時熵為最大值。因此熵反映了信息源中所包含的平均信息量的大小。
地形匹配導(dǎo)航所利用的是地形的高程信息,地形的起伏、變化及光滑程度等特征主要通過高程信息的變化來體現(xiàn)。不同地形區(qū)域內(nèi)的高程分布規(guī)律是不同的,所以其包含的信息量也不同,起伏變化較大的地形包含了較多的信息量,而起伏變化較小的地形包含的信息量則較少,作為反映地形特征的高程數(shù)據(jù)也可以用熵來進行衡量,稱其為地形熵。文中基于此考慮提出了基于地形熵的地形適配區(qū)的選擇準則。
假定匹配模板的大小為M×N(格網(wǎng)),模板中心格網(wǎng)點的坐標為(m,n),任意一點(i,j)的高程為h(i,j)(見圖1)。
圖1 匹配模板與數(shù)字地圖
假定地形高程均為正值(有負值時可以統(tǒng)一加上一正數(shù)),由此定義局部地形熵為:
式中Hf為局部的地形熵。由于上式定義的局部地形熵在計算時涉及對數(shù)運算,計算量比較大,為簡化計算,可利用泰勒展開得到如下的近似公式:
在計算局部地形熵的基礎(chǔ)上,采用邏輯函數(shù)G來定義地形適配區(qū)的判決準則:
式中,HT為局部地形熵的閾值,可根據(jù)實驗來測定。
根據(jù)局部地形熵來進行適配區(qū)選擇具有以下特點:
1)局部地形熵反映了地形所含有信息量的大小,因此局部地形熵可描述地形的性質(zhì)。如果某局部區(qū)域高程值變化越急劇,起伏變化越大,地形越獨特,則計算出的局部地形熵就越?。环駝t,計算出來的地形熵就大。所以熵小的區(qū)域,適合作為匹配區(qū)域。
2)地形熵具有剔除離散點的作用。從局部地形熵的定義中可以看到:如果地形在小的范圍內(nèi)存在離散點(即奇異點),由于地形熵的大小依賴于整個局部地形區(qū)域的高程值,單個數(shù)據(jù)點的高程值對地形熵的影響很小,所以局部地形的地形熵變化較小。
3)因為熵對一定程度的基準誤差是不敏感的,所以用局部地形熵來選擇適配區(qū)具有良好的抗基準誤差能力。對一組平均值為770.6m的200個地形高程數(shù)據(jù)計算地形熵后發(fā)現(xiàn),在原來高程的基礎(chǔ)上對每個地形高程數(shù)據(jù)增加100m,其平均高程變化了12.98%,而地形熵值從原來的2.30095變到了2.30097,只變化了0.01%。
在給出適配區(qū)選擇準則的基礎(chǔ)上,文中進行了大量的仿真實驗,實驗結(jié)果表明只要選取合適的地形熵閾值,該準則總能得到較好的地形適配區(qū)域。選取DEM數(shù)字地圖中的一塊區(qū)域來進行仿真,其大小為90×50(格網(wǎng)),格網(wǎng)間距為50m,圖2是該區(qū)域?qū)?yīng)的三維地形起伏圖。
該地形區(qū)域所對應(yīng)的等高線如圖3所示。
圖3 地形的等高線圖
在所選地形區(qū)域的基礎(chǔ)上,取匹配模板窗口大小為20×20(格網(wǎng)),采用傳統(tǒng)的基于地形統(tǒng)計參數(shù)的選擇準則得到的適配區(qū)域
如圖4中黑色部分所示(系統(tǒng)總噪聲標準差σN取15m)。而采用基于地形熵的選擇準則得到的適配區(qū)域如圖5中黑色部分所示(地形熵的閾值取為9.286時)。
圖4 基于地形統(tǒng)計參數(shù)準則得到的適配區(qū)域
圖5 基于地形熵準則得到的適配區(qū)域
比較圖4和圖5,發(fā)現(xiàn)兩種準則得到的適配區(qū)域基本相同,說明了文中所提出的基于地形熵的適配區(qū)選擇準則具有較好的適配區(qū)選擇效果。
[1]張祖勛.數(shù)字攝影測量學(xué)[M].武漢:武漢測繪科技大學(xué)出版社,1997.
[2]李志林.數(shù)字高程模型[M].武漢:武漢大學(xué)出版社,2007.
[3]朱繼文.基于影像匹配數(shù)據(jù)獲取DEM方法探討[J].黑龍江工程學(xué)院學(xué)報,2009,23(1):36-38.
[4]王華.基于地形熵和地形差異熵的綜合地形匹配算法[J].計算機技術(shù)與發(fā)展,2007,17(9):25-27.
[5]王偉.一種改進的地形熵匹配導(dǎo)航算法[J].計算機仿真,2007,24(2):11-13.